The U. S. House of Representatives passed a resolution condemning Russia's illegal abduction of Ukrainian children and calling it an attempt to destroy the next generation of Ukraine.
33 countries have joined the International Coalition for the Return of Ukrainian Children, led by Ukraine and Canada, which aims to multiply efforts to return Ukrainian children deported to Russia.

Ukraine has submitted applications and risk assessments to U. S. and European aviation regulators to resume civilian air service at one of its airports, although no timeline has been set due to complex security issues.

Ukraine's president warned that without new US military aid, Ukraine will not be able to protect the Black Sea shipping corridor, which provides grain exports that are crucial to world food markets.
